No.  Not sure what I was thinking.  I probably was thinking one 3390-9. 
But the balance between too big and too small has to do with how many
volumes are needed.  So a little more free space may force another mod-3
for example (in an all mod-3 configuration).  I know 3390-3 is an issue for 
how big the unix root is getting.  If it gets larger than a mod 3 (fast 
approaching), IBM may have to split it up because there are shops that
just can't get past the 90s and use (at least) mod 9s.
